    Abstract: Provided are a method and device for fault estimation of a measurement and control device for a rotary steerable drilling system. The method for fault estimation includes: S1, establishing a state model of the measurement and control device for the rotary steerable drilling system; S2, establishing a fault-free model filter and a fault model filter, and initializing the fault-free model filter and the fault model filter; S3, detecting whether the measurement and control device for the rotary steerable drilling system has a fault; and S4, reinitializing the fault model filter under the condition that a detection result is fault-free; reinitializing the fault-free model filter under the condition that the detection result is faulty; and estimating, by the fault model filter, the fault in real time, and obtaining, by the fault model filter, the estimation value {circumflex over (x)}wf.

    Abstract: A memory comprises a substrate and a plurality of storage units formed on the substrate. Each of the storage units includes a transistor and a capacitor electrically connected to the transistor. The transistor includes a gate, a semiconductor layer, a first electrode, a second electrode, and a gate dielectric layer. The first electrode and the second electrode are arranged in a first direction. The gate is located between the first electrode and the second electrode. The semiconductor layer is located on one of two opposite sides of the gate in a second direction. The semiconductor layer is electrically connected separately to the first electrode and the second electrode, the gate and the semiconductor layer are isolated from each other by the gate dielectric layer, and the second direction is a direction parallel to the substrate.

    Abstract: The present invention belongs to the technical field of oil field drilling, and relates to a ground testing device for a stabilized platform of a rotary steerable drilling tool. The ground testing device includes: a first supporting member and a second supporting member that are oppositely arranged, where the second supporting member is provided with a first mounting hole; a drill collar and a drill collar motor mounted outside the first supporting member, where a motor shaft of the drill collar motor penetrates the first supporting member and is connected to the drill collar, and a stabilized platform mounting assembly is arranged inside the drill collar; and a first vibration member connected to the drill collar and a second vibration member arranged in the first mounting hole in a sleeved manner, where an elastic member is arranged between the second vibration member and the second supporting member, and the elastic member is arranged on the second vibration member in a sleeving manner.

    Abstract: A method and an apparatus of mapping table reconstruction based on a SSD, and a computer device are disclosed by the present application, and the method includes: acquiring the mapping table reconstruction request based on the SSD; scanning starting from the last physical page of the corresponding physical block according to the mapping table reconstruction request based on the SSD; reading the corresponding logical address and N logical address offsets from a data area of the current physical page, where N is the positive integer greater than 1; acquiring logical addresses corresponding to N adjacent pages in sequence according to the logical address corresponding to the current physical page and the N logical address offsets; reconstructing a mapping relationship between logical addresses and physical addresses according to the logical address corresponding to the current physical page and the logical addresses corresponding to the N adjacent pages.

    Abstract: A method and an apparatus for upgrading a SSD firmware compatible with an RAID and a non-RAID is provided. The method includes: packing two firmware versions including an RAID firmware and a non-RAID firmware together, when the two firmware versions need to be released; adding a configuration information with a fixed length of bytes to a firmware header of a resulting packed firmware, where the configuration information includes: index values, offsets, and file sizes of the RAID firmware and the non-RAID firmware; determining, according to an internal information of an SSD, whether a matching firmware version thereof is the RAID firmware or the non-RAID firmware; and comparing the internal information of the SSD with the configuration information of the firmware header, selecting a matching index value, and reading a corresponding firmware according to the offset and the file size.

    Abstract: The present application discloses a method and a device for marking dirty bits of an L2P table based on a SSD, the method includes: obtaining a marking request of dirty bits in the L2P table based on the solid state drive; and broadening a corresponding dirty bit in the L2P table to 2 bits according to the request; and setting the dirty bit from a binary number 00 to a binary number 01 through a state machine when a first write command request is obtained; setting the dirty bit from the binary number 01 to a binary number 10 through the state machine when flush operation starts; and setting the dirty bit from the binary number 10 to a binary number 11 through the state machine when a second write command request is obtained during the flush operation.

    Abstract: A lightning strike probability-based coordinated power control method for an energy storage system and a load adjusts output power of an energy storage system and a regulatable load based on a real-time predicted lightning strike probability. This reduces a correlation between a power grid in a lightning region and an external power grid, minimizes impact of a lightning strike if any on the external power grid, and decreases an economic loss due to the lightning strike in the lightning region. The present disclosure establishes a relationship between the output power of the energy storage system, the regulated power of the regulatable load, and a lightning strike probability in a same region, and then regulates the power of the energy storage system and the regulatable load in real time based on the lightning strike probability.

    Abstract: A method of reducing FTL address mapping space, including: S1, obtaining a mpa and an offset according to a logical page address; S2, determining whether the mpa is hit in a cache; S3, determining whether a NAND is written into the mpa; S4, performing a nomap load operation, and returning an invalid mapping; S5, performing a map load operation; S6, directly searching a mpci representing a position of the mpa in the cache and searching a physical page address gppa with reference to the offset; S7, determining whether a mapping from a logical address to a physical address needs to be modified; S8, modifying a mapping table corresponding to the mpci in the cache, and marking a mp corresponding to the mpci as a dirty mp; S9, determining whether to trigger a condition of writing the mp into the NAND; and S10, writing the dirty mp into the NAND.

    Abstract: Embodiments of the present disclosure provide a game character rendering method and apparatus, an electronic device, and a computer-readable medium. The method includes: obtaining a mesh model corresponding to each part of the game character, when a triggering operation for changing the game character's equipment is detected; determining, according to the triggering operation for the changing equipment, equipment texture and equipment data corresponding to each part; obtaining a combined game character, by combining mesh models and equipment textures corresponding to respective parts based on the equipment data; and rendering the combined game character. The present disclose may recombine parts obtained after splitting a mesh model of a game character during equipment change of the character, and then perform integral rendering, such that only one rendering is required, and the efficiency of rendering is improved.

    Abstract: The disclosure discloses a laser opto-ultrasonic dual detection method and device using a pulse laser incident on the surface of a sample to generate plasma and the optical emission and ultrasonic waves are generated, to simultaneously analyze the element compositions, structural defects and residual stress of the sample. The detection system includes an excitation unit, a spectrum detection module, an ultrasonic detection module and an analysis control module. The digital delayer generator is connected to the computer, the high-precision 3D displacement platform is electrically connected to the digital delayer generator. The the pulsed laser is focused on and incident onto the surface of the sample to be tested through modulation of the optical path system to generate plasma, which simultaneously generate optical emission and ultrasonic waves. The ultrasonic detection unit is configured to detect the ultrasonic waves. The spectrum detection unit is configured to detect the plasma emission spectrum.

    Abstract: The invention relates to a dynamic point-the-bit rotary steerable drilling tool and a measuring method thereof. The dynamic point-the-bit rotary steerable drilling tool comprises a rotary housing, a stabilized platform assembly, a hollow servo-motor assembly, a drilling fluid passage, an inner eccentric ring, an outer eccentric ring, a drilling bit shaft and a universal joint. The dynamic point-the-bit rotary steerable drilling tool also comprises a stabilized platform communication and power supply system which includes an instrument storehouse fixed at the upper end of the rotary housing, a main circuit board, an auxiliary circuit board mounted on the stabilized platform upper-end cover, an electromagnetic coupler primary-side, an electromagnetic coupler secondary winding and an electromagnetic coupler primary-side mounting plate fixed at the lower end of a coupler.

    Abstract: The present invention relates to a novel method for producing astaxanthin by using microalgae. The method comprises: heterotrophic cultivation of microalgae, dilution, photo-induction, collection of microalgal cells, and extraction of astaxanthin. The method according to the present invention takes full advantages of rapid growth rate in the heterotrophic stage and fast accumulation of astaxanthin in the photo-induction stage by using a large amount of microalgal cells obtained in the heterotrophic cultivation stage, so as to greatly improve the astaxanthin production rate and thereby achieve low cost, high efficiency, large scale production of astaxanthin by using microalgae. The method not only provides an important technical means to address the large scale industrial production of astaxanthin through microalgae but also ensures an ample source of raw material for the widespread utilization of astaxanthin.
